Change in the Oligomeric State of α-Synuclein Variants in Living Cells.
ACS chemical neuroscience - 20 Apr 2022
Fan Hsiu-Fang, Chen Wen-Ling, Chen Yan-Zhow, Huang Jian-Wei, Shen Yu-Xin
Abstract excerpt
The accumulation of β-sheet-rich α-synuclein (α-Syn) protein in human brain cells is a pathological hallmark of Parkinson's disease (PD). Moreover, it has been reported that familial PD mutations (A30P, E46K, H50Q, G51D, and A53T) accumulate at an accelerated rate both in vivo and in vitro. In addition, accumulations of various C-terminal α-Syn truncations, such as C-terminal-truncated N103 α-synuclein (N103),...
